Transaction 81e7f41b661762424ba53e48c95b828d48eee661caceb43be75759fb3dcd86e4
1 Input
1 Output
-
81e7f41b661762424ba53e48c95b828d48eee661caceb43be75759fb3dcd86e4:0
- value
- 2549893
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b2b3a36959159ab29bb5c98179e13dbddfda79d
- address
- bc1qdv4n5d54j9v6k2dmtjvp08snm0wlmfualjulyc